The Duality of Power and Luxury in Pop Smoke's 'AP'

Pop Smoke's 'AP' is a vivid portrayal of the duality between power and luxury, encapsulated in the life of a young, successful artist. The song's title, 'AP,' refers to the Audemars Piguet watch, a symbol of wealth and status. Throughout the lyrics, Pop Smoke juxtaposes his luxurious lifestyle with the harsh realities of street life, creating a complex narrative that reflects his personal experiences and the environment he emerged from.

The recurring lines 'AP, Spicy / I bust a check in my Nikes / Am I a killa? Might be / Two tone, icy' highlight this duality. The 'AP' and 'icy' references signify his success and the material rewards that come with it, while the question 'Am I a killa? Might be' hints at the violent undertones of his past and the constant threat of danger. This blend of opulence and menace is a recurring theme in Pop Smoke's music, reflecting the precarious balance he navigated between his newfound fame and his roots.

The song also delves into themes of loyalty and aggression. Lines like 'Talk to me nice or don’t talk at all' and 'I make a call and it’s war' emphasize the importance of respect and the swift, often violent, consequences of disrespect. The mention of Adderall suggests a heightened state of alertness and readiness for conflict, further underscoring the tension that permeates his world. Additionally, the references to firearms and violence, such as 'I got 52 shots in this Glock' and 'Niggas will shoot you for nothing,' paint a stark picture of the dangers that lurk beneath the surface of his glamorous lifestyle.

Pop Smoke's 'AP' is a raw and unfiltered glimpse into the life of an artist who straddled the line between luxury and survival. It captures the essence of his journey, marked by both triumph and turmoil, and serves as a testament to the complex realities faced by many in similar circumstances.
